Why couldn't he change on the 2nd level??
Jon McCaleb That rule came in later in the run....The fall of 1978. This was from one of the very first months of this version of Card Sharks.
Ok, that makes sense.
Jon McCalebNot only that, the loss on a PUSH rule didn't get abandoned until about 1979 or 1980.
I knew about the push thing. As a matter of fact the C64 game that was released during the Eubanks era never ceased the push rule in the bonus round either.
Jon McCalebI've played the Apple II game, and I can't remember if the push rule was used there or not.
